A Long Tradition of Holiday Lighting
Holiday decorations have a deep tradition in Santa Fe. The custom started with Spanish settlers who used luminarias—paper lanterns filled with sand and a candle—to light the way to church on Christmas Eve. Over the years, this tradition has grown, and now Santa Fe’s streets are lined with beautiful Christmas decorations that showcase the city’s rich history and culture. Outdoor Christmas lights light up homes, shops, and historic buildings, adding to the festive charm.

Canyon Road Farolito Walk: A Winter Wonderland
One of the best ways to experience Santa Fe’s holiday light displays is by walking down Canyon Road. Every year, the road is lined with farolitos (paper lanterns) and luminarias, creating a peaceful, magical atmosphere. The warm glow from these traditional Christmas lights fills the air, making Canyon Road feel like a scene from a holiday postcard. The Light of the Nights: A Festival of Lights
For those who enjoy a great light show, La Luz de las Noches at the Santa Fe Botanical Garden is a must-see. This event features thousands of outdoor Christmas lights that transform the garden into a glowing wonderland. With live music, hot drinks, and lots of holiday cheer, this festival is a magical way to experience Santa Fe’s holiday lights in a quieter setting.

Santa Fe’s Unique Christmas Trees
The Christmas trees and Christmas tree toppers in Santa Fe are unlike any other. While many places use traditional tree decorations, Santa Fe’s trees often include local touches, like pinecones, chili peppers, and handmade Christmas ornaments. These special decorations reflect the city’s Southwestern style, making the holiday season feel even more unique.
